N-COUNT
庆祝活动;庆典
A celebration is a special enjoyable event that people organize because something pleasant has happened or because it is someone's birthday or anniversary.

Noun
1. a joyful occasion for special festivities to mark some happy event
2. any joyous diversion
3. the public performance of a sacrament or solemn ceremony with all appropriate ritual;
"the celebration of marriage"
